Job description
Bambee is looking for a Technical Diligence Lead to take a close, honest look at our existing systems - architecture, security, and vendor relationships - and make sure they hold up under scrutiny. Youâll work in close partnership with our VP of Engineering and senior leadership, setting standards and priorities for what gets fixed and in what order. This is a senior, high-visibility role: youâll carry real authority over technical risk decisions company-wide, without formally managing the engineering team day to day.
Responsibilities
- Audit Bambeeâs existing architecture, codebase, and infrastructure for technical risk
- Set standards and remediation priorities for technical risk across the organization, in partnership with the VP of Engineering
- Review our security posture and identify gaps that wouldnât hold up under external scrutiny
- Evaluate our vendor and third-party integrations for risk exposure
- Produce clear, prioritized findings - written for both engineers and non-technical stakeholders
- Advise senior leadership directly on technical risk and readiness
- Assess our data infrastructure for how it could support future products
Requirements
- 8+ years in software engineering, including experience operating at a senior or staff level with real technical authority
- A track record of shaping technical direction and standards without necessarily managing a team
- Experience conducting audits, security reviews, or technical assessments of existing systems
- Strong written communication and comfort advising executives directly
